阅片单元评估表单CRF配置时,数值问题的属性:影像标记应该是独立的,不应该依赖于是否必填
continuous-integration/drone/push Build is failing
Details
continuous-integration/drone/push Build is failing
Details
parent
1b753ed416
commit
174a1ddf5e
|
@ -727,7 +727,7 @@
|
||||||
}}
|
}}
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
<!-- 影像标记 -->
|
<!-- 影像标记:disabled="form.IsRequired === 0" -->
|
||||||
<el-form-item
|
<el-form-item
|
||||||
v-if="form.Type === 'number' && !isFromSystem && readingVersionEnum"
|
v-if="form.Type === 'number' && !isFromSystem && readingVersionEnum"
|
||||||
:label="$t('trials:readingUnit:qsList:title:imageMarkEnum')"
|
:label="$t('trials:readingUnit:qsList:title:imageMarkEnum')"
|
||||||
|
@ -735,7 +735,7 @@
|
||||||
>
|
>
|
||||||
<el-radio-group
|
<el-radio-group
|
||||||
v-model="form.ImageMarkEnum"
|
v-model="form.ImageMarkEnum"
|
||||||
:disabled="form.IsRequired === 0"
|
|
||||||
@change="imageMarkEnumChange"
|
@change="imageMarkEnumChange"
|
||||||
>
|
>
|
||||||
<el-radio v-for="item of $d.ImageMark" :key="item.id" :label="item.value" :disabled="form.IsRequired === 2 && item.value === 1">{{ item.label }}</el-radio>
|
<el-radio v-for="item of $d.ImageMark" :key="item.id" :label="item.value" :disabled="form.IsRequired === 2 && item.value === 1">{{ item.label }}</el-radio>
|
||||||
|
@ -1531,9 +1531,9 @@ export default {
|
||||||
form.RelevanceId = ''
|
form.RelevanceId = ''
|
||||||
form.RelevanceValueList = []
|
form.RelevanceValueList = []
|
||||||
}
|
}
|
||||||
if (val === 0 && form.Type === 'number' && !this.isFromSystem) {
|
// if (val === 0 && form.Type === 'number' && !this.isFromSystem) {
|
||||||
form.ImageMarkEnum = 1
|
// form.ImageMarkEnum = 1
|
||||||
}
|
// }
|
||||||
if (val === 2 && form.Type === 'number' && !this.isFromSystem) {
|
if (val === 2 && form.Type === 'number' && !this.isFromSystem) {
|
||||||
form.ImageMarkEnum = 0
|
form.ImageMarkEnum = 0
|
||||||
}
|
}
|
||||||
|
|
|
@ -429,7 +429,7 @@
|
||||||
<i class="el-icon-info" />{{ [1, 2, 3, 4].includes(form.CustomCalculateMark) ? $t('trials:readingUnit:qsList:message:msg1') : $t('trials:readingUnit:qsList:message:msg2') }}
|
<i class="el-icon-info" />{{ [1, 2, 3, 4].includes(form.CustomCalculateMark) ? $t('trials:readingUnit:qsList:message:msg1') : $t('trials:readingUnit:qsList:message:msg2') }}
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
<!-- 影像标记 -->
|
<!-- 影像标记:disabled="form.IsRequired === 0" -->
|
||||||
<el-form-item
|
<el-form-item
|
||||||
v-if="form.Type === 'number' && !isFromSystem && readingVersionEnum"
|
v-if="form.Type === 'number' && !isFromSystem && readingVersionEnum"
|
||||||
:label="$t('trials:readingUnit:qsList:title:imageMarkEnum')"
|
:label="$t('trials:readingUnit:qsList:title:imageMarkEnum')"
|
||||||
|
@ -437,7 +437,7 @@
|
||||||
>
|
>
|
||||||
<el-radio-group
|
<el-radio-group
|
||||||
v-model="form.ImageMarkEnum"
|
v-model="form.ImageMarkEnum"
|
||||||
:disabled="form.IsRequired === 0"
|
|
||||||
@change="imageMarkEnumChange"
|
@change="imageMarkEnumChange"
|
||||||
>
|
>
|
||||||
<el-radio v-for="item of $d.ImageMark" :key="item.id" :label="item.value" :disabled="form.IsRequired === 2 && item.value === 1">{{ item.label }}</el-radio>
|
<el-radio v-for="item of $d.ImageMark" :key="item.id" :label="item.value" :disabled="form.IsRequired === 2 && item.value === 1">{{ item.label }}</el-radio>
|
||||||
|
@ -1344,9 +1344,9 @@ export default {
|
||||||
form.RelevanceId = ''
|
form.RelevanceId = ''
|
||||||
form.RelevanceValueList = []
|
form.RelevanceValueList = []
|
||||||
}
|
}
|
||||||
if (val === 0 && form.Type === 'number' && !this.isFromSystem) {
|
// if (val === 0 && form.Type === 'number' && !this.isFromSystem) {
|
||||||
form.ImageMarkEnum = 1
|
// form.ImageMarkEnum = 1
|
||||||
}
|
// }
|
||||||
if (val === 2 && form.Type === 'number' && !this.isFromSystem) {
|
if (val === 2 && form.Type === 'number' && !this.isFromSystem) {
|
||||||
form.ImageMarkEnum = 0
|
form.ImageMarkEnum = 0
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ue